CIVIL WAR ERA WHEELCHAIR
A neat Civil War-era relic, a wooden wheelchair marked "Duer Genuine Spaulding Fiber Balto.", measuring 45" high, with three wheels tricycle style, the front being 26" in diameter. It has a 17" leather seat, fastening with brass nails. Very probably used for injured soldiers. Overall expected wear, particularly to seat, very good condition.
